The president of the Chilean Bishops’ Conference, Bishop Alejandro Goic, will celebrate a Liturgy of Thanksgiving for the successful rescue of the 33 miners who were trapped at the San Jose mine.

The liturgy will take place Oct. 25 at the National Shrine of Maipu. The 33 miners as well as the Chilean President Sebastian Pinera will be present at the ecumenical celebration. 

The Chilean Bishops’ Conference issued a press release explaining that the liturgy will be an opportunity to show “gratitude to the Lord for the happy end to Operation San Lorenzo” and to offer prayers “for the intentions of the miners and their families.”

The bishops invited all who live in or near the country's capital city of Santiago to take part in the liturgy. They also encouraged those who cannot attend to join in prayer from their homes or communities.

The 33 miners from the San Jose mine were rescued on Oct. 13 after spending 69 days trapped below ground when the mine collapsed.
